Day 2 Animal Kingdom
We were up bright and early to open the Animal Kingdom park. Our fabulous bus driver from the day before had told us get there when the park opens and go straight to the safari trail ride because they put the food out along the trail just before opening. We did as instructed and scored! All the animals were out and we got great views of everything, including baby elephants and rhinos! We spent the day touring the park, Colin still sick but hanging in there, until the boys all got soaked on the river rapids ride and were freezing. We had to call it quits after that and head back to the hotel to dry out and change. Later that night we went over to Downtown Disney to meet up with my family that had arrived that day. We had a great dinner catching up and seeing my family that I haven't seen in years. Colin was super excited to see his cousin Charlotte now that he is old enough to remember her.

Travel to the US
Colin and I have not been back to the US since we left to move to Germany back in 2009. We were excited to take in a lot of sights and visit with family who we hadn't seen in a while. To get to Florida from this little island is a two day event. We left Terceira about 9 AM on a Friday and flew to the larger island of São Miguel. From there we had a long layover of several hours before our flight for the US left. Our next door neighbor, Rosanne, has a very close family friend that is Portuguese and lives on our island. Odilia and her family spent Thanksgiving with us if you remember. Odilia's daughter happens to live on the island of São Miguel and when Odilia heard we had a layover there she asked if we would mind carrying on some things to take to her. Of course we didn't mind, so Catarina met us at the airport to get her stuff and offered to drive us around and show us some of the island. So nice of her! The weather was not cooperating very much at all and it was typical island winter weather of rain and wind. We saw some of the downtown area, some of the port area and then spent a good deal of time in the mall that is there to stay dry.
Later that afternoon it was time to board our long flight to Boston. We arrived in Boston and as we expected it was COLD! No snow, but pretty cold for us island dwellers. Since we were spending our whole vacation in Florida we didn't really have any cold weather clothes, so we just had to suck it up for the night there until we could board our plane for Jacksonville the next day. Colin was THRILLED to finally arrive at Grandma & Grandpa's house after two days of travel anticipation. He and his cousins were so cute and funny together. Colin and Dawson met when they were infants, and have Skyped now that they are older, but this was the first time they have met now that they are old enough to understand. It was our first time meeting Brennan too. The first night we were in Keystone we took the kids to the Keystone Christmas parade and grilled oysters out on the grill. Colin tried oysters for the first time and loved them! The kids had a blast and Colin was WIPED OUT by the end of the night, as were Shelby and I.
